Bonsoir, j'ai installé MySQL et depuis hier j essaye de créer un
utilisateur et je n y arrive pas...
J'ai la version 3.22.32
Apres l installation j'ai commencé par donner un mot de passe au root en
faisant:
update user set password="mot_de_passe" where user="root" ;
Cette commande a bien donné, j'ai pu le vérifier en faisant:
select user, password from user ;
Ensuite j'ai créé une base de données:
create database test_db ;
ce qui a également fonctionné, j'ai pu le vérifier en faisant:
show databases ;
(tiens question subsidiaire: Où se trouve la table des bd ? autrement dit
je dois faire un select "koi" pour voir les bd ?)
Maintenant rien ne va plus.
J'aimerais créer un administrateur pour la base de données test_db. J'ai
donc fait ceci, comme indiqué dans 2 ouvrages (différents) que je possède:
grant all on test_db.* to testAdmin identified by "pass_admin" with grant
option ;
Ici il me répond: Query OK, 0 rows affected.
Et de fait, si je vérifie, je n'ai pas de nouvel utilisateur créé....
Quelqu'un pourrait il m'aider
Merci.
STef
PS: Autre question: comment faire pour empecher les gens qui n ont pas de
compte sur le serveur MySQL de se connecter sur ce serveur? Autrement dit
comment faire pour obliger les gens à se connecter avec une commande de
type: mysql -u login -p ?
--
To UNSUBSCRIBE, email to [EMAIL PROTECTED]
with a subject of "unsubscribe". Trouble? Contact [EMAIL PROTECTED]